温馨提示×

debian cpustat网络影响

小樊
57
2025-08-03 15:44:56
栏目: 智能运维

cpustat 是一个用于监控 Linux 系统 CPU 使用情况的工具,它是 sysstat 包的一部分。在 Debian 系统中,你可以使用 apt-getdpkg 命令来安装它。

关于 cpustat 对网络的影响,通常来说,cpustat 本身对网络的影响是非常小的,因为它主要关注 CPU 的使用情况,而不是网络活动。然而,在某些情况下,如果系统负载非常高,cpustat 可能会消耗更多的 CPU 资源,从而间接地影响到网络性能。

以下是一些可能的情况:

  1. 高 CPU 负载:如果系统负载非常高,cpustat 可能会消耗更多的 CPU 资源来收集和处理数据。这可能会导致其他进程(包括网络相关的进程)获得较少的 CPU 时间,从而影响网络性能。

  2. 频繁的数据收集:如果你配置 cpustat 以非常高的频率收集数据,它可能会对 CPU 造成额外的负担。这同样可能间接地影响到网络性能。

  3. 资源竞争:在资源受限的系统上,cpustat 可能会与其他进程竞争 CPU 资源。这可能导致网络相关的进程获得较少的 CPU 时间,从而影响网络性能。

为了减轻 cpustat 对网络的影响,你可以考虑以下几点:

  • 调整数据收集频率:根据你的需求调整 cpustat 的数据收集频率,以减少对 CPU 的负担。
  • 优化系统配置:确保你的系统具有足够的 CPU 资源来满足所有进程的需求。这可以通过升级硬件、优化系统配置或限制某些进程的资源使用来实现。
  • 监控系统性能:定期监控系统的 CPU 和网络性能,以便及时发现并解决潜在的问题。

总之,虽然 cpustat 本身对网络的影响通常很小,但在某些情况下,它可能会间接地影响到网络性能。通过调整数据收集频率、优化系统配置和监控系统性能,你可以减轻这种影响。

0